Archie Milon "Buck" Adams, 87, of Sale City died Tuesday, December 19, 2017 at his residence.

Graveside funeral services will be 2:00 p.m. Saturday, December 23 at Cool Springs Baptist Church Cemetery. Rev. Tom Rodgers will officiate.

Born December 17, 1930 in Newton, GA, Mr. Adams was the son of the late Archie Adams and Florie Holt Adams Croker. He was married to the late Betty Jean Adams and was also preceded in death by a son, Mike Adams, brother, Jimmy Adams, and sister, Lelia M. Lundy. Mr. Adams was a veteran of the United States Navy and retired from the Marine Corp. Logistics Base of Albany. He was a member of Cool Springs Baptist Church. Mr. Adams was an avid turkey hunter and fisherman and true confederate rebel.

Survivors include a daughter, Chan Bell (James); a son, Scott Adams (Rosalind); a brother, Mike Adams; ten grandchildren, Jeb Bell, Bob Bell, Katie Williams, Leah Deason, Tyler Sizemore, Brittany Harris, Tiffany Harris, Dru Shierling, Tal Shierling, Emma Shierling; four great grandchildren, Cole Williams, Kamryn Williams, Carson Williams, and Faulton Bell; three nephews, Jeff Adams, Chris Adams, and Matt Adams.

Visitation will be from 1 to 2 p.m. Saturday, before services, in the social hall at Cool Springs Baptist Church.

Parker-Bramlett Funeral Home is in charge of arrangements.
